Restoration of Old Manuscripts using Image Processing Techniques

2000 
Image processing, one of the rapidly expanding area of present day science and technology, finds useful applications in many fields such as medicine, space, remote sensing and document processing. In this paper a simple and effective method is proposed to preserve and produce restored copies of old and faded manuscripts. The manuscripts are here treated as images and edge detection technique is used for the purpose of restoration of these images. The method is tested by applying it to some artificially degraded documents and to some actual old manuscripts ivolving Arabic, Persian and Urdu text. Hard copies of the original manuscripts obtained after restoration were found to be much better as compared to the original or their xerox copies.
